On September 19, SteelOrbis reported ex-US scrap deals on containerized HMS I/II 80:20 to Taiwan trading at $285-293/mt CFR. According to sources close to SteelOrbis, deals are most recently reported at $283-285/mt CFR Taiwan. This range represents a price erosion of $2/mt from the bottom of the previously reported range and $8/mt from the top of the same range.
Due to a weak domestic steel market and lower Chinese product pricing that may limit export opportunities for Taiwanese products, a source noted the increased likelihood that Taiwan will continue buying scrap predominantly in the domestic market with limited imports until the market situation becomes clearer.
Bids on containerized HMS I/II 80:20 are reported at $278-280/mt CFR Taiwan with offers at $290-295/mt CFR Taiwan.
